International Advanced Manufacturing Park

The International Advanced Manufacturing Park (IAMP)  is located within the administrative boundaries of Sunderland and South Tyneside and represents a unique opportunity for the automotive and advanced manufacturing sectors in the UK.

In order to support the delivery of the IAMP, Sunderland and South Tyneside Councils secured funding through a City Deal to prepare an Area Action Plan (AAP) for the site which would remove 150 hectares (ha) of land from the Green Belt and allocate it for development

Following an Examination in Public into the soundness of the IAMP AAP by an independent Planning Inspector appointed by the Secretary of State, both Councils formally adopted the IAMP AAP on 30 November 2017.

The    IAMP AAP (PDF) [8MB]    forms part of the adopted development plans for both Sunderland and South Tyneside Councils and sets the planning policy framework against which applications within the IAMP area are assessed

Plan Review

In order to ensure that local planning policies remain effective and up to date, the NPPF requires policies within Local Plans to be reviewed, and where necessary updated, at least every five years.

As the IAMP AAP was adopted on 30 November 2017 a review of the IAMP AAP was undertaken in October 2022.  This review concluded that the policies of the AAP remain effective and consistent with national policy.
